Does anyone know approx. what time self disembarkation begins after a TA (in Brooklyn)? My flight was just changed and what to make sure we can make it. Thanks!

 

For self-help disembarkation we have usually been off by 7am. Last month it was 6.35am.

When do you arrive? I believe for the time being QM2 may be docking in Manhattan instead of Red Hook due to damage done to a gangway by the Caribbean Princess when it docked during high winds on 5/9 (though the Caribbean Princess has continued docking in Brooklyn since then).

 

FYI, the Caribbean Princess came in late on 5/9 and was further delayed due to the gangway problem. I think they started disembarking some time after 9 am. Friends that were originally in the 9 am disembarkation group made it off the ship about 10:10 am. Others that had earlier time slots disembarked after them. Suite passeners were delayed due their baggage not being offloaded first. So, you never know what could happen.

Once we did self-disembarkation only once (I think it was QM2 4th of July 2008 cruise). It was an absolute nightmare because they had some problem (with the gangway, I suppose---the exact problem wasn't explained). Long lines of passengers carrying their bags were directed and redirected to different points of the ship for over an hour until they finally got a gangway secure. Not a happy experience.:eek:

 

I understand that kind of thing doesn't happen often, but best to factor in that it can happen. -S.

In my experience, cabs are surprisingly "iffy" at Red Hook when QM2 arrives. I've seen people standing around in line waiting for cabs to show up. So to be on the safe side, you might inquire with Cunard about their transfer to JFK (be sure they know the time of your flight) or pre-arrange a car with one of the services in NYC.
